35 years of Techne Consulting

November 6, 2021 Techne Consulting celebrated 35 years of consulting and software development in the fields of environment and energy. In these 35 years we have worked with leading energy and environmental Italian institutions (Ministry of Environment, Regions, National and Regional Environmental Protection Agencies) and with research institutions (ENEA, CNR, ISPRA, universities, etc.), We participated in the most important international working groups on air pollution (from CORINAIR 85 project), we have published many original scientific papers that have often anticipated the problems that would emerge in subsequent years. Among other things we have been pioneers in stressing the importance of an integrated approach to energy and air quality planning indicating the possible negative influences on air quality of the combustion of solid biomass. We also developed the first model of assessment of pollutant emissions from ships in the specific Transport programme under 4th Research and Technology Development Framework Programme of the European Commission.

Horizon 2020 iCHANGE final event at EGU 25

On April 28, 2025, during the European Geosciences Union (EGU) in Vienna, the H2020 I-CHANGE project, of which Techne Consulting is a partner, held its final scientific event titled “From Citizens to Science: Tools Driving Climate Action”. Over the past four year, I-CHANGE has worked to place citizens at the core of climate action, demonstrating that informed, empowered communities are essential for achieving behavioural change. By combining active citizen participation, innovative technologies, and scientific collaboration, the project has fostered behavioural transformations towards more sustainable living.

EXperts Panel on Polluting Emissions Reduction (EXPAPER 2024)

Presented on November 8, 2024 at ACI in Rome as part of the EXperts Panel on Polluting Emissions Reduction (EXPAPER 2024) the work Emissioni delle navi nei porti liguri: trend, COVID, proiezioni e implementazione Area NECA.

The work describes the emissions of air pollutants in Ligurian ports in 2021, discussing the effects of prolonged ship stops in port due to COVID. Subsequently, future emissions are estimated by evaluating the effects of increased traffic, regulations and electrification of ports. Finally, the effects of a hypothetical introduction of a NECA area (nitrogen oxide emission control area) are discussed.

AirLabò Project (Interreg Italia-Francia Marittimo 2021-2027)

Techne Consulting is a partner of the consortium of institutions and companies of the AirLabò project within the Interreg Italy-France Maritime Cross-border Programme 2021-2027, co-financed by the European Regional Development Fund (ERDF), within the European Territorial Cooperation (ETC) objective of the EU Cohesion Policy 2021 - 2027

The AirLabò project methodology consists of a process of interaction between the main stakeholders identified in three groups: port infrastructure managers, scientific monitoring and control institutions and citizens.

Sustainable Development and Planning 2024

The Technical Director of Techne Consulting, a partner in the ICHANGE project, presented a paper with some of the project’s results last week at the 13th International Conference on Sustainable Development and Planning held in Seville from 23 to 25 September 2024.  At the conference was registered 81 people from all continents with different professional backgrounds who share an interest in sustainable planning. 

The invited presentation first provided an overview of environmental footprints used to assess the impacts of human activities on the environment. The Horizon 2020 I-CHANGE project was then introduced, which addresses the challenge of engaging and promoting active citizen participation to address climate change, sustainable development and environmental protection. Finally, environmental footprint methodologies were applied based on the information collected by the Living Labs on daily activities, traffic simulation results and statistical data to calculate specific footprints in the base case and in the alternative scenarios for different Living Labs in the I-CHANGE project.
